About
The Royal Windsor Triathlon is one of UK's most legendary multisport challenges. It takes place in Windsor, Berkshire. the 2026 edition will take place on the 14 June 2026.
The first Royal Windsor Triathlon was created in 1991, and 34 years later is now firmly established as one of the top events in the triathlon calendar. Few triathlons can compare with the historical backdrop of Windsor Castle, the majestic River Thames, the green vista of the Long Walk and the stunning overall surroundings of Windsor.

Route information
Start your summer strong at one of the UK's most iconic multisport events the Royal Windsor Triathlon returns on Sunday 14th June 2026! With Sprint, Standard, and Relay options available, this award-winning race is perfect for triathletes of all abilities.
The day begins with an open water swim in the River Thames keep an eye out for swans! Next, take on a thrilling road cycle through the historic town of Windsor, passing Windsor Castle and heading into the scenic countryside. You’ll finish with a memorable run into Windsor Great Park, along the iconic Long Walk, with the castle framing your final strides.
Whether you’re going solo or teaming up for the relay, the Royal Windsor Triathlon is a must do event with a royal backdrop and a buzzing race village atmosphere.

Distances:
Sprint Triathlon
750m swim, 20km bike and 5km run
Standard Triathlon
1500m swim, 40km bike and 10km run

How to get there
Alexandra Gardens, Windsor SL4 1RF, UK
Get full directionsPARKING/TRAVEL
There will be parking at Windsor Boys’ School cricket pitches. There’s additional parking within the surrounding roads.
Getting to Windsor by car
Windsor is just 30 miles west of London and is easily accessible via the major motorway networks. From M3 exit at Junction 3 (Bagshot), from M4 exit at Junction 6 (Windsor), from M25 exit at Junction 13 (Egham) and from M40 exit at Junction 4 (Marlow) or Junction 2 (Beaconsfield).
Long stay car parks are located at Romney Lock, King Edward VII Avenue and Alexandra Gardens. All are cheaper than the more central (shopping) car parks and are less than a 10 minute walk to Windsor Castle for spectators.
Getting to Windsor by train
Windsor is served by two train stations, Central and Riverside. Both are situation within a few minutes walk of Windsor Castle. First Great Western operates services from London Paddington, you then need to change at Slough onto the branch line that links with Windsor & Eton Central Station.
South West Trains operates direct services from London Waterloo to Windsor & Eton Riverside Station (journey time approximately 55 minutes). Please check train times prior to travelling, to ensure you can arrive in time for the early Sunday start.

MINIMUM AGES
Sprint Distance - 15 years and above
Standard Distance - 17 years and above
BAGGAGE
We will have a secure marquee where you can leave your baggage. We recommend you bring as little baggage as possible. Your baggage tag is attached to your race number, you simply tear it off and attach to your bag. To collect, show your number to our staff and they will help you find your baggage.
TOILETS
In the Event Village and two water stations on the run route.
REFRESHMENTS
There will be water provided at the start of the run, and there will also be water available at the finish along with your post race goodies and medal.
